Is Orca based on a true story?

The 1977 film Orca is a fictional thriller directed by Michael Anderson. It depicts a vengeful killer whale seeking retribution against a reckless captain in a Newfoundland harbor after the loss of its mate and offspring, rather than documenting actual historical events involving marine life.

What is the central conflict in Orca?

The central conflict in Orca involves a vengeful killer whale terrorizing a Newfoundland harbor. The beast targets a captain responsible for killing its mate and offspring, forcing the captain, a marine biologist, and an Indigenous tribalist to confront the creature on its own turf.
